Legal Practice Seminar is designed for JD amd MSLA candidates. The official course description states: "Students learn how effective law practice administrators and managers base policy and management decisions on a comprehensive understanding of the law firm as a complex and interdependent equation. This course provides an overview of the business functions of a law practice." At the beginning of the course, the students broke into groups with the intent of planning and designing a law firm. The final consisted of presenting a PowerPoint and live presentation by each group pitching their ideas and strategy for their firms. I joined with two JD candidates and another MSLA candidate to form the Law Offices of Crough & Schenck. Throughout the semester stages of the final presentation were completed as group deliverables.
